Valley Center, June 2, 2025 -

A traffic collision occurred today at 12415 Mesa Verde Drive in Valley Center, CA, involving one vehicle, a black Volkswagen sedan, which struck a fence. The incident was reported at approximately 11:06 PM, prompting a rapid response from the California Highway Patrol (CHP) to manage the scene effectively.

Fortunately, there were no lane closures reported, allowing traffic to flow without significant interruptions. CHP officers took control of the area, focusing on ensuring the safety of the roadway and the surrounding environment. A tow truck was called to assist in the recovery of the vehicle, which was located on private property.

As the situation was handled, there were no indications of delays or congestion for motorists in the vicinity. The CHP worked diligently to clear the scene and facilitate a smooth recovery process. Although damage to the wooden fence was noted, it was outside the jurisdiction of the CHP.
